>백엔드 개발 >PHP 문제 >PHP 마크다운을 HTML로 변환하는 방법

PHP 마크다운을 HTML로 변환하는 방법

藏色散人
藏色散人원래의
2020-09-29 10:06:432969검색

PHP 마크다운을 HTML로 변환하는 방법: 1. Parsedown 변환 라이브러리를 사용하여 마크다운을 HTML로 변환합니다. 2. PHP 마크다운 도구를 사용하여 마크다운을 HTML로 변환합니다.

PHP 마크다운을 HTML로 변환하는 방법

추천: "PHP 비디오 튜토리얼"

HTML 오픈 소스 라이브러리에 대한 두 가지 PHP 버전의 마크다운

markdown 작성 방법이 대중화되었으며, 다양한 편집기에 마크다운이 내장되어 있습니다. 파서는 변환할 수 있습니다. 그렇다면 마크다운 텍스트를 HTML로 변환하는 유사한 라이브러리가 PHP에 있습니까? 네, 오늘은 2가지 모델을 소개하겠습니다.

1. Parsedown

HTML 오픈 소스 라이브러리에 두 가지 PHP 버전의 마크다운을 소개합니다

Parsedown은 매우 작은 PHP 마크다운 변환 라이브러리로, PHP 파일이 하나만 있고 코드도 매우 유능하며 실행 효율성도 매우 좋습니다. 빠른.

비교만 보면 알 수 있습니다

HTML 오픈 소스 라이브러리에 두 가지 PHP 버전의 마크다운을 소개합니다

특정 코드:

<?php
$Parsedown = new Parsedown();
echo $Parsedown->text(&#39;Hello _Parsedown_!&#39;); # prints: <p>Hello <em>Parsedown</em>!</p>
?>

두 번째, PHP Markdown

PHP Markdown에는 PHP Markdown 파서 및 추가 기능이 포함되어 있습니다. 동일한 수준 PHP Markdown Extra로.

Markdown은 웹 작성자를 위한 텍스트-HTML 변환 도구입니다. 마크다운을 사용하면 읽기 쉽고 쓰기 쉬운 일반 텍스트 형식으로 작성한 다음 구조적으로 유효한 XHTML(또는 HTML)로 변환할 수 있습니다.

"마크다운"은 실제로 두 가지입니다. 일반 텍스트 마크업 구문과 원래 Perl로 작성되어 일반 텍스트 마크업을 HTML로 변환하는 소프트웨어 도구입니다. PHP Markdown은 John Gruber의 원래 Markdown 프로그램의 PHP 포트입니다.

php 마크다운은 인터프리터와 필터 기능을 자동으로 사용할 수도 있는데, 이는 매우 강력합니다.

코드 변환

<?php
use Michelf\Markdown;
$my_html = Markdown::defaultTransform($my_text);
?>

두 PHP 마크다운 모두 매우 강력합니다.

두 마크다운 온라인 웹사이트 주소는 http://editor.bfw입니다. wiki/Studio/Open.html?projectid=15759698453773380035

github https://github.com/erusev/parsedown

github https://github.com/michelf/php-markdown

위 내용은 PHP 마크다운을 HTML로 변환하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.